Comptroller – Cowichan – Duncan, BC

Salary Range: $83,844.18 – $98,179.81

Reference No. ADM-FIN-COMP-0915

Purpose: Reporting to the General Manager, the successful candidate will be responsible for financial reporting, business planning and budgeting, forecasting and scenario analysis, financial accounting and compliance, performance measurement and controllership functions for the Cowichan Tribes organization.

Responsibilities:

Leads and manages a team of reporting management and staff, the incumbent provides controllership functions within established policy, Chief and Council directives and goals, legislation, guidelines, financial plans and budgets
Discusses, presents, and provides information and reports to the General Manager and Chief and Council with accurate reliable financial information and recommendations; participates in special projects and provides senior level financial expertise and input as assigned
Provides leadership, oversight and acts as a financial advocate for the Cowichan Tribes Financial Administration Law to ensure all legislative and legal requirements are met; reviews and approves monthly and quarterly financial statements and related adjustments prior to presentation of Chief and Council; oversees and manages cash management and investment strategies
Leads and manages Cowichan Tribes finance related information system and related projects as a process and system owner and user
Collaborates with center, department, and program managers as well as Cowichan Tribes committees and band-owned companies on common financial and accounting issues
Sponsors and oversees the year end audit process in accordance with established policies and practices and reviews auditor’s reports and prepares recommendations for changes and actions to correct problem areas or deficiencies
Researches and analyzes best practices, emerging financial analysis, control, costing and other developments and innovations, financial trends, applied technology and process change via external networking and conferences
Prepares, manages and controls Finance Department financial plans, budgets and expenses

Required Education and Experience:

Undergraduate degree and a recognized professional accounting designation is required
Minimum 5 years of progressive financial and management control, planning, policy and strategy development experience in a complex multi-department organization is required

Required Skills, Knowledge and Abilities:

Strong knowledge and understanding of process and change management, project management, financial planning and control processes and methods
Excellent oral, written, presentation and interpersonal communication, business and financial analysis skills
Thorough knowledge of Cowichan Tribes business and management operations is desirable
Thorough knowledge of the Indian Act and related financial provisions is preferred
